三峡库区碎石土抗剪强度指标的试验研究

摘    要:以现场取得的碎石土为原料,通过筛分试验,确定其平均级配,以平均级配为基础,利用代替法设计试验级配。在试样含水量的确定上,抛弃了传统含水量的确定方法,结合碎石土的特点,以碎石土中细粒的多少来确定试样的含水量。在制样上抛弃了以往用控制干密度制样的方法,改用相同竖向压力下制样的新方法。对库区不同碎石含量、不同含水量的碎石土剪切强度进行了试验研究。根据抗剪强度与细粒含水量及碎石含量的变化关系,以细粒的液性指数和碎石含量为指标,提出了碎石土抗剪强度的实用计算公式。

关 键 词:碎石土  抗剪强度  试验研究  实用公式

Experiment research on shear strength index of gravel-soil in Three-Gorge reservoir area
Authors:Shi Wei-ming  Zheng Hong-lu  Liu Wen-ping  Zheng Ying-ren
Abstract:With the in-situ gravel-soil as trial materials, mean gradation is determined by particle size analysis. On the basis of the mean gradation, test grading is designed with substitution method. According to the character of gravel-soil, the water content of samples is determined according to the content of clay, abandoning accustomed way for the decision of soil. The samples are made under same vertical pressure, giving up the traditional method by controlling dry density. Density and shear strength of gravel-soil with different content of gravel and water in the Three Georges Reservoir Zone (TGRZ) are considered with laboratory studies. According to the relation between shear strength and water content of clay and content of gravel, a practical formula for shear strength of gravel-soil is put forward with liquidity index of clay and content of gravel.
Keywords:gravel-soil  sheer strength  experiment research  practical formula
